3.1 Wall mounting
The unit must only be located in dry interior locations. In order to function fault-
lessly, the device must be protected from strong electromagnetic elds in the se-
lected mounting location.
Please pay attention to separate routing
of bus cables and mains cables.
1. Choose a mounting location.
2. Drill 2 holes (Ø 6 mm, centres 113 mm) and insert the wall plugs.
3. Fasten the base part of the housing by means of the enclosed screws (4 x 40 mm)

3.2 Electrical connection
Carry out the connection of the Datalogger to other modules in the
order described below:
1. Connect the data cable (RESOL VBus
®
, ) to the RESOL controller . If nec-
essary, extend the cable using the terminal block included and a common two-
wire cable.
2. Plug the mains adapter into a socket.
3. For a direct connection to a router or a PC, connect the Datalogger to a rout-
er or a PC using the network cable (included with the DL2, ).
The cables carry low voltage and must not run together in a cable conduit with
cables carrying a voltage higher than 50 V (please pay attention to the valid local
regulations).

Power supply is carried out via an external mains adapter. The supply voltage of the
mains adapter must be 100 240 V~ (50 60 Hz).
The DL2 Datalogger comes with the mains adapter and the VBus
®
cable pre-con-
nected.
